There’s no guarantee that it’s a better car. Furthermore, because of the low miles it may have plastic or rubber parts that are dried out and need replacement from sitting whereas they may be done already on a car that was driven more. You’ve just got to look closely and assess.

Do not trust a dealer ppi of their own car. That is just a starting point. Get an jndekendwnt shop to do another one on your dime. I’m still saying grey car based on cost and use. Anything under 100k is low miles on these cars.
